What You'll Do
You'll support Parks & Recreation facilities by handling a variety of cleaning, maintenance, and support tasks that keep City spaces operating smoothly for staff and the public.
Key Responsibilities
- Perform janitorial and facility cleaning using daily, weekly, and monthly checklists
- Maintain cleanliness of buildings, restrooms, grounds, and surrounding areas
- Assist maintenance, cleaning, and trade crews with assigned tasks
- Safely operate equipment and vehicles; report vandalism or repair needs
- Complete basic reports and follow City safety rules and work procedures
What You Bring – Education & Experience
- At least 18 years old with three years of high school completed
- Any combination of related work or hands-on experience is helpful
Preferred Certifications
- Valid Indiana Driver's License (as required for assigned duties)
Technical Skills & Knowledge
- Ability to use basic hand and power tools
- Comfort working with cleaning products and maintenance equipment
- Ability to follow oral and written instructions and work with moderate supervision
